Coinbase

Coinbase is widely recognized as one of the safest cryptocurrency exchanges available. Founded in 2012 and headquartered in the United States, Coinbase has established a reputation for security, reliability, and regulatory compliance.

Key safety features of Coinbase include:

  1. Regulatory Compliance: Coinbase complies with the regulatory standards of various countries, including the United States. It adheres to Anti-Money Laundering (AML) and Know Your Customer (KYC) regulations.
  2. Insurance Coverage: Coinbase provides insurance coverage for digital assets stored on its platform. In the event of a security breach or hack, users’ funds are protected.
  3. Cold Storage: The majority of user funds on Coinbase are stored in cold storage, which means they are not connected to the internet and are less vulnerable to cyberattacks.
  4.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Coinbase offers 2FA as an additional security layer for user accounts. This adds an extra barrier to unauthorized access.
  5. Regular Security Audits: Coinbase undergoes regular security audits and assessments to ensure the safety of its platform and users’ assets.

Coinbase’s commitment to security and regulatory compliance makes it a preferred choice for both beginners and experienced cryptocurrency traders looking for a safe and reliable exchange to buy, sell, and store their digital assets.

Gemini

Gemini is among the safest cryptocurrency exchanges globally, known for its strong commitment to security and regulatory compliance. Founded in 2014 by the Winklevoss twins, Gemini has prioritized user protection and trust.

Key safety features of Gemini include:

1. Regulatory Compliance: Gemini operates under the oversight of the New York State Department of Financial Services (NYDFS) and adheres to strict regulatory standards, making it one of the most heavily regulated exchanges in the industry.

2. Cold Storage: The majority of user funds are stored in offline, air-gapped cold storage, reducing the risk of online hacks.

3. Insurance: Gemini provides insurance coverage for digital assets held on its platform, offering additional protection in case of security breaches.

4.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Users can enable 2FA for their accounts, adding an extra layer of security.

5. Security Audits: Gemini undergoes regular security audits and assessments to maintain the highest security standards.

Gemini’s user-focused approach to security and regulatory compliance has earned it a solid reputation as one of the safest exchanges for cryptocurrency trading and investment.
